Overview of Doane University
Doane University, founded in 1872, is a private liberal arts institution located in Crete, Nebraska. It is known for its commitment to providing quality education and fostering personal growth. The university offers various undergraduate and graduate programs, including a robust selection of online courses. The online anatomy and physiology program is aimed at providing students with a strong foundation in biological sciences, essential for careers in healthcare, education, and research.
Program Structure
The online anatomy and physiology program at Doane University is designed to be both comprehensive and flexible. The curriculum typically consists of two main courses:
Anatomy
1. Course Content: This course covers the structure of the human body, including the study of cells, tissues, organs, and systems. Students will learn about:
- Skeletal system
- Muscular system
- Nervous system
- Circulatory system
- Respiratory system
- Digestive system
- Reproductive system
2. Laboratory Component: Although the course is online, there may be virtual lab experiences or optional in-person lab sessions to enhance the learning experience. These labs often include dissections, histology slides, and interactive 3D models.
Physiology
1. Course Content: This course focuses on the functions of the human body and how different systems work together to maintain homeostasis. Key topics typically included are:
- Cellular physiology
- Neurophysiology
- Endocrine system functions
- Cardiovascular physiology
- Respiratory physiology
- Renal physiology
- Gastrointestinal physiology
2. Assessment Methods: Students are assessed through various methods, including quizzes, tests, and projects, ensuring a comprehensive evaluation of their understanding and application of the material learned.

Frequently Asked Questions
What online courses does Doane University offer for Anatomy and Physiology?
Doane University offers a range of online courses in Anatomy and Physiology, including introductory courses, advanced topics, and lab components designed to provide a comprehensive understanding of human anatomy and physiological processes.
Are the online Anatomy and Physiology courses at Doane University accredited?
Yes, Doane University's online Anatomy and Physiology courses are accredited by the Higher Learning Commission, ensuring that they meet high educational standards.
How do online Anatomy and Physiology courses at Doane University assess student performance?
Student performance in online Anatomy and Physiology courses at Doane University is assessed through a combination of quizzes, exams, lab reports, and participation in online discussions.
What is the duration of the online Anatomy and Physiology courses at Doane University?
The duration of online Anatomy and Physiology courses at Doane University typically ranges from 8 to 16 weeks, depending on the specific course format and schedule.
